#8c278f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#8c278f is composed of 54.9% red, 15.3% green and 56.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2.1% cyan, 72.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 43.9% black. It has a hue angle of 298.3 degrees, a saturation of 57.1% and a lightness of 35.7%. #8c278f color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4eff with #19001f. Closest websafe color is: #993399.

#8c278f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#8c278f has RGB values of R:140, G:39, B:143 and CMYK values of C:0.02, M:0.73, Y:0,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 9185167.

Shades and Tints of #8c278f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040104 is the darkest color, while #fcf4f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#8c278f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5e585e is the less saturated color, while #ad04b2 is the most saturated one.
